Output e21062742c26a16de2d35206f8e69ddf05d6e937af1cc626c34087a87ed5f0a2:0

value
774979
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50111bf1d018022a1db32324f7e8efa4d5fe7227 OP_EQUALVERIFY OP_CHECKSIG
address
18JMZ7UT5cUt98YBz5PM1DH8g7ZXbkKUxX
transaction
e21062742c26a16de2d35206f8e69ddf05d6e937af1cc626c34087a87ed5f0a2
confirmations
507043
spent
true